Overview
Brilliant colors, remarkable diversity, and extraordinary evolutionary adaptations have made cichlid fish one of the most studied groups of freshwater fish in the world. Found in lakes and rivers across Africa, the Americas, Madagascar, and parts of Asia, cichlids display an astonishing variety of shapes, behaviors, and ecological roles.
Among their greatest strongholds are Africa's Great Lakes, particularly Lake Malawi, Lake Tanganyika, and Lake Victoria, where hundreds of species have evolved over millions of years. Their rapid diversification has made cichlids a model group for scientists studying evolution, ecology, genetics, and animal behavior.
Today, cichlid fish are valued not only for their ecological importance but also for their popularity in aquariums, conservation programs, and scientific research around the world.
Definition
Cichlids are freshwater fish belonging to the family Cichlidae, one of the largest and most diverse families of vertebrates. More than 1,700 species have been formally described, while researchers believe many additional species remain undiscovered.
The family includes fish ranging from only a few centimeters long to species exceeding half a meter in length, occupying habitats that vary from rocky shorelines and sandy lake bottoms to rivers, wetlands, and tropical streams.
Why Cichlid Fish Matter
Cichlids play an important role in freshwater ecosystems by helping maintain ecological balance through feeding, breeding, and interactions with other aquatic species. Many are predators, algae grazers, or insect feeders, contributing to healthy aquatic food webs.
Their exceptional diversity has also transformed cichlids into one of biology's most valuable research groups. Scientists study them to understand speciation, adaptation, sexual selection, genetics, and the processes that generate biodiversity.
A Remarkable Evolutionary Story
Few groups of vertebrates have diversified as rapidly as African cichlids. In lakes such as Malawi and Tanganyika, hundreds of closely related species evolved from common ancestors, adapting to different habitats, diets, and ecological niches. This rapid evolutionary radiation has become one of the world's best-known examples of adaptive evolution.
Because many species exist only within a single lake or even a single section of shoreline, protecting their habitats has become a major conservation priority.

Conservation and Challenges
Many cichlid species face growing threats from habitat destruction, pollution, invasive species, overfishing, and climate change. Because numerous species are found only within individual lakes or isolated habitats, environmental changes can have significant impacts on their survival. Conservation programs, protected areas, scientific monitoring, and sustainable fisheries play important roles in safeguarding these remarkable fish.
Lake Malawi National Park and other protected freshwater ecosystems help conserve many endemic cichlid species while supporting research, education, and responsible ecotourism.
Interesting Facts
- More than 1,700 cichlid species have been scientifically described, with many more believed to remain undiscovered.
- Lake Malawi is home to hundreds of endemic cichlid species found nowhere else on Earth.
- Cichlids exhibit some of the most diverse parental care behaviors among fish, including mouthbrooding.
- The family Cichlidae is one of the largest vertebrate families in the world.
- Many cichlids display brilliant colors used for courtship, communication, and territorial behavior.
- Scientists frequently study cichlids to better understand evolution and the formation of new species.
